What is a part time AutoCAD job?

Part time AutoCAD jobs involve using AutoCAD software to create, modify, or review technical drawings and blueprints, typically for architecture, engineering, or construction projects, but on a part time schedule. Professionals in these roles may work as drafters, designers, or CAD technicians, assisting teams with detailed design work while balancing other commitments or jobs. These positions often require proficiency in AutoCAD and an understanding of industry-specific standards, but offer flexible hours, which can be ideal for students, freelancers, or those seeking supplemental income.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time AutoCAD professional?

To thrive as a Part Time AutoCAD professional, you need proficiency in computer-aided design (CAD), strong spatial reasoning, and relevant education or experience in drafting or engineering. Familiarity with AutoCAD software, industry-specific standards, and potentially certifications like Autodesk Certified User are typically expected. Attention to detail, time management, and effective communication are valuable soft skills in this role. These competencies ensure the accurate, efficient creation of technical drawings and effective collaboration with project teams.

What are some common challenges faced by part time AutoCAD professionals, and how can they be managed?

Part-time AutoCAD professionals often face challenges such as tight project deadlines, limited access to team meetings, and adapting quickly to varying project scopes. Balancing multiple projects or clients with restricted hours can make time management crucial. To succeed, it’s helpful to maintain clear communication with supervisors and team members, stay organized with project files, and proactively seek feedback on deliverables. Utilizing collaboration tools and setting regular check-ins can also help stay aligned with the full-time team, ensuring smooth workflow and project integration.

Role description: Arcadis DPS Group has multiple openings for experienced BIM Designers (Mechanical, Process, and/or Electrical) to join our team in Boise, Idaho. Candidates will have direct experience supporting advanced technology tool installation projects within the semiconductor industry, working with multi-disciplinary teams comprised of Designers, Engineers, Project Managers, Coordinators, and field construction personnel.

The successful candidates will have experience with 2D/3D detailing, design, and modeling. Strong proficiency in AutoCAD is required, and Revit is strongly preferred. Proven success with facility design for cleanrooms, laboratories, and MEP Tool install design in semiconductor fabs.

We will also entertain remote support, only for professionals with direct semiconductor tool install design experience. Role accountabilities: Work directly with lead engineers and designers on large scale industrial facilities. Utilize state of the art design and modelling software such as AutoCAD and Revit.

An understanding of project lifecycle related to tool installation scope and discipline specific deliverables. Ability to coordinate and interact effectively across multi-disciplined teams. Identifying deliverables, defining requirements, and creating design drawings.

Develop layouts while working in tandem with project managers and engineers on multiple projects simultaneously. Others tasks as assigned. Qualifications & Experience: 2-5 years of experience in the AEC industry, with a focus on Mechanical and/or Process systems.

Working knowledge of relevant CADD software programs; AutoCAD/BIM/Revit, along with Microsoft Office suite. Background in drafting and design (associate's degree minimum preferred). Strong written and verbal communication skills (English).

Strongly motivated, well organized, and shows professional initiative. Ability to work in a fast-paced and challenging environment. Team player who can work with a variety of software, projects, and other individuals.
